This Masterclass Certificate in Aerospace Materials for Athletic Equipment provides in-depth knowledge of advanced materials used in high-performance sports gear. Participants will gain a comprehensive understanding of material selection, processing, and testing, crucial for designing lighter, stronger, and more durable athletic equipment.
Learning outcomes include mastering the properties of carbon fiber, titanium alloys, and other advanced composites; understanding fatigue and fracture mechanics relevant to athletic applications; and applying finite element analysis (FEA) to optimize material usage in design. The program also covers the latest research and development in aerospace materials and their translation to athletic equipment.
